You can try websites like Wattpad. There are many users on Wattpad who share their own lesbian - themed fiction novels for free. It has a large community and a wide variety of genres within lesbian fiction, from romance to adventure.
Another option is Archive of Our Own (AO3). It's a well - known platform that hosts a vast amount of fanfiction, including lesbian fiction novels. The great thing about AO3 is that it allows for a lot of different interpretations and styles of writing, and it's all free to access.

Often, free online lesbian fiction can be very inclusive. They might include characters from different ethnic backgrounds, ages, and social classes, representing the real - life diversity within the lesbian community. In terms of themes, love and acceptance are common, but there are also stories that explore the challenges lesbians face in society, like discrimination. The writing styles can vary greatly, from very descriptive and flowery to more straightforward and modern, depending on the author's preference.

Archive of Our Own (AO3) is a popular place. It has a large collection of fan - created content, including a significant amount of lesbian fiction. It's free to access and read. The site has a great tagging system which makes it easy to find exactly what you're looking for.
You can try some free e - book platforms like Project Gutenberg. Although it may not have a large dedicated section for lesbian fiction specifically, but it has a vast collection of classic literature and some works might fall into this category. There's 'Fingersmith' by Sarah Waters. While it may not be strictly a modern - day 'lesbian novel' in the purest sense as it's set in a different era, it has strong lesbian themes and is often available for free online. It's a complex and engaging story of love, betrayal, and mystery among the characters. Also, 'Carmilla' is an older work that has been adapted many times and can be found free online. It was one of the early works to explore lesbian themes in a somewhat veiled but still impactful way.

Another characteristic is the focus on female empowerment. Many lesbian online fictions feature strong female characters who are not defined by traditional gender roles. They are often independent, making their own choices in love and life. For instance, in 'Fingersmith', the two main characters are constantly taking control of their situations despite the many obstacles in their way, which is inspiring for female readers.
